A New Breed of Agriculture: The Power of Grafting
In the fertile heartlands of North India, a quiet agricultural revolution is brewing, spearheaded by an unexpected figure: an MBA dropout. This visionary has harnessed the remarkable potential of grafting technology to cultivate the region’s first ever disease-resistant vegetables, turning traditional farming on its head and generating an impressive ₹90 lakh in revenue.
The Concept of Grafting Technology
Grafting technology involves creating a new plant by joining the tissues of two different plants, combining their strengths while often producing a hardier, more resilient specimen. This technique is not new; it has been employed in agriculture for centuries. However, its recent application in vegetable farming in North India marks a significant turning point.
- What is Grafting? A horticultural technique that improves plant qualities.
- Benefits: Greater resistance to disease, improved yield, and adaptability to various climates.
- Application: Suitable for fruits, vegetables, and even ornamental plants.

The Impact on Local Farming Communities
Not only has this innovation been financially rewarding, but it has also made a significant impact on local farming communities. The introduction of disease-resistant vegetables means:
- Higher Income for Farmers: With increased yield and reduced losses from diseases, farmers can enjoy better financial stability.
- Food Security: Healthier crops can contribute to greater food availability in the region.
- Environmental Sustainability: Reduced need for chemical pesticides, making farming practices more sustainable.
